Each face of a cube has an area of 400 cm2. what is the volume of the cube?

A cube is a square shape, so both sides ( length and width) of a face would be the same.

Find the length of the side by finding the square root of the area of the face:

Length = √400 = 20 cm.

Volume is Length x Width X height.

Volume = 20 x 20 x 20 = 8,000 cm^3

The term used to describe a customer who sees a pair of boots online but then decides to buy the same pair at Macy's after trying them on would be best classified as a cross-channel shopper.

<h3>Who is a cross-channel shopper?</h3>

A cross-channel shopper is a consumer who uses various combination of both several channels for the same purchase.

The customer has checked the pair of boots online but rather purchased the same boots at Macy's instead of purchasing online.

Therefore, a cross-channel shopper uses different purchasing channel to purchase a product.
